Little Warley is a village in the Brentwood district, in the county of Essex, England.
It is situated south of Thorndon Country Park.
[1] On 1 April 1934 the parish was abolished and merged with Brentwood, Essex, except for a smaller part south of the railway which went to Little Burstead.
[2] Since 2003 the area around St Peter's Church, but not the entire former parish, has formed part of the reconstituted civil parish of West Horndon.
